Richard A. “Shamu” Crossman, Jr., 53, of Shelby, died Sunday, November 30, 2014 at Ohio Health MedCentral/Shelby Hospital, Shelby, after an apparent heart attack.
Rick was born in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ania on April 18, 1961 to Richard and Diane (Zellefrow) Crossman. His mother passed away on April 10, when Rick was eight years old. Rick was raised by his father Dick Crossman, Sr., who survives him with his wife Cynthia in Wesley Chapel, FL.
Shamu graduated from Crestline High School, Class of 1981. He was a member of the Richland County Coon Hunters Club. Rick has worked at HiStat in Lexington for the past 2 years. Rick became a member of the Arcana Lodge #272, Crestline in February 28, 1991 and is now a member of Galion Lodge #414, Free & Accepted Masons, Galion. He was very proud to have played with the Shelby Blues semi-pro football team. Shamu was also known locally as an umpire, umpiring both high school and Little League baseball games. Rick loved to golf. He loved motorcycles, especially his Harley. Rick was a proud father of his children.
He is also survived by his son, Nickolaus “Lil Shamu” Crossman and Abrigayle Lowe, Lucas, and his daughter, Emily D. Crossman, Shelby. Rick is survived by April Enzor, his significant other and partner of fourteen years. He was looking forward to the birth of his first grandchild in February, 2015 his grandson Bentley Allen Crossman.
He was preceded in death by an infant brother, Edward Crossman.
